Assignment Task

A study of the literature establishes the need for more research and gives context.
You will synthesize and evaluate existing research on your subject in your literature
review by pointing out the advantages, disadvantages, similarities, and differences
between your sources.

To complete this assignment, you will investigate your subject and then write a
comprehensive, well-structured literature review that incorporates your own
evaluation of at least six academic sources and their contributions to your subject.

An academic source is usually a peer-reviewed journal article or book/book chapter
written by experts on the subject. Literature can be sourced by entering key words
into data bases such as Google Scholar, Pub-Med, Science Direct etc… and a
process of inclusion and exclusion is described to explain why literature was
selected for the assignment. An annotated bibliography, which merely enumerates
sources and provides summaries, is not the same as a literature review.

Another way that a literature review varies from a research paper is that it doesn’t contain any
fresh arguments or unreported primary research.

Your literature review should have three parts: an introduction, a body, and a conclusion.

Introduction

Describe your research subject and any relevant background information in the
beginning to make the context of your source review clear. Additionally, you want to
note any overlaps, contradictions, and/or gaps in the literature. Briefly describe how
you decided on the literature for review. Lastly, you should describe the standards by
which you have analysed, contrasted, and compared the sources.

Body ( this heading must reflect the content – do not use the term ‘body”)
Discuss your sources in the main body of the assignment. Sort the sources you discuss
according to a shared feature, such as the goals, conclusions, or findings of the writers;
research methods; or chronological order. Give a succinct synopsis of each source and a
description of its advantages and disadvantages. Determine, evaluate, and discuss the
contributions made by each source to the subject. Use lead-in words and citations to
incorporate source information.

Conclusion

Begin this section by stating the purpose of the review. The conclusion should give
the reader a summary of the main arguments and conclusions drawn from the
literature. Describe how your sources have advanced knowledge and
comprehension of the subject and point out any weaknesses you have identified.
Respond to the following questions: What information about the subject has your
review of the literature revealed or demonstrated? Can you recommend areas for
further research following your review of the literature on the chosen subject?
